I have had an ongoing nightmare with Lowe's. It's been 10 months and they can't seem to get my kitchen finished. We are considering hiring an attorney. Their "install" manager can't seem to follow through on anything and once we started following up on what he was doing (since he would say things were ordered that weren't, orders went in wrong, etc) he has gotten belligerent and is now purposely sabotaging efforts to get this done. Their regional office got involved a few months ago and got the project moving and am hoping they will advocate for me again. We are 7 months past the "completion" date of the project. I have documented everything and saved all e-mails and it is obvious the total lack of concern and unwillingness to try to move to get this done. The install manager has been downright hostile. I have had no problem with the current crew working at my home (after getting rid of the first crew who was unreliable) Just the install guy who cannot manage a project to save his life and obviously has never been taught how to handle a customer issue. And his bosses at the store don't seem to care either. Once they got us to sign on the dotted line for $20,000, we were pushed to the back burner.

Anyone have any advice or experience with this?

    Patricia - you are right. Covid accounted for a 2 month delay in the arrival of the cabinets. We ordered them on January 31st and completion date in contract was April 4th. Cabinets did not end up arriving until May 25th, but we totally understand that. It's just constant mismanagement since then. I may as well have hired the crew myself and done all the ordering of the cabinets myself as I had to check over every subsequent order. Things all didn't come in right the first time so we have had to place orders 3 more times for a few things each time. Can you imagine when they are already behind on this installation and I have to send them the exact things to order (the install manager says he has no idea about ordering so I detail it out for him) and then it takes them 9 days before he sends the order to the manufacturer! I kept asking for PO numbers and he would say they were ordered and I finally called the cabinet manufacturer directly and no order. Trust me, it's total mismanagement and even the store manager seems to not care and condone the horrible behavior of their employees since he never says or does anything about the situation, even though he has been made aware!1 The "designer", who ordered things wrong, said he refused to speak to me----he threw an absolute hissy fit in the store when I came in an calmly asked to see what was ordered---and the store manager had to come and "force" him to do his job. AND---of course, it was wrong again! Supposed to order fridge panels with right end finished and he had ordered left end finished. Even though he had my e-mail telling him EXACTLY what to order.
